What Are The Ingredients For Jalapeno Balls Recipe?The ingredients for Jalapeno Balls are: ? 12 ounces cream cheese, softened? 1 (8 ounce) package shredded Cheddar cheese ? 1 tablespoon bacon bits ? 12 ounces jalapeno peppers, seeded and chopped ? 1 cup milk ? 1 cup all-purpose flour ? 1 cup dry bread crumbs ? 2 quarts oil for frying How Do I Make Jalapeno Balls?Here is how you make Jalapeno Balls: 1. In a medium bowl, mix the cream cheese, Cheddar cheese jalapenos and bacon bits. Roll into walnut size balls place, on cookie sheet put into freezer freeze 30 minutes2. Put the milk and flour into two separate small bowls. Dip the jalapenos balls first into the milk then into the flour, making sure they are well coated with each. Freeze the jalapenos balls for another 30 minutes.3. Dip the jalapeno balls in milk again and roll them through the breadcrumbs. Allow them to dry, 10 minutes ( may be frozen again at this point and kept until ready to fry).4. In a medium skillet, heat the oil to 365 degrees F ( 180 degrees C). Deep fry the coated jalapeno balls 2 to 3 minutes each, until golden brown. Remove and let drain on a paper towel.
